16 student-athletes representing the Northeast-10 Conference were selected as CoSIDA / Capital One Academic All-District selections it was announced this week. The 2012 Capital One Academic All‐District Teams are selected by the College Sports Information Directors of America, and honor the nation’s top student‐athletes for their combined performances
athletically and in the classroom.

The Adelphi University women's basketball team conducted a free clinic for the Roosevelt Middle School girls' basketball team on May 3. Thanks to Roosevelt Head Coach Lauren Williams, the Panthers were able to use the facilities to work with the girls on their offensive and defensive skills, while placing an emphasis on communication, work ethic and teamwork.
